Meyrueis is a commune in the Lozère département in southern France.The town of Meyrueis is located between the foothills of Mount Aigoual to the south, and the Causse Mejean to the north. The town thus marks the border between the geographic areas of the Grand Causses, Causses Noir and Causse Mejean, and the Cevennes Mountains. Three rivers are meeting there : the Jonte, the Bethuson and the Brèze. The communal territory stretches over 10,468 hectares, delimitated by a rectangle of 25 km long and 10 km wide, with an average altitude of 706 meters, and a highlight of 1562 meters.The neighbouring towns are Saint-Pierre-des-Tripiers and Hures-la-Parade to the north, Gatuzières to the east, Saint-Sauveur-Camprieu and Lanuéjols to the south. Finally, to the south-west, we find the commune of Veyreau in the Aveyron.
